Joachim Murat was born in March 1767 and was executed in October 1815. He was an officer of the French army, its general and marshal of the Empire during the Napoleonic Wars (1799-1815), as well as the king of Naples in the years 1808-1815. The future king and marshal of France volunteered in 1787 at the age of 20. He served there during the revolutionary wars (1792-1799), gaining considerable military experience. At that time, he fought, inter alia, during the Italian campaign (1796-1797), as Napoleon Bonaparte's adjutant and during the Egyptian campaign. In 1799, he became a major general. In 1800, he married Napoleon's sister, Karolina Bonaparte, and in the same year took part in the Battle of Marengo. In 1804 he became the marshal of France, and a year later - the cavalry commander of the Grand Army. He was most famous for the daring actions of his cavalry during the campaigns of 1805 and 1806. Especially in the latter, his cavalrymen were able to force the Prussian fortresses to surrender, which was a phenomenon! In 1808 he was awarded the title of King of Naples. He took part in the Russian campaign in 1812, but did not show any military talent there. A year later, he took part in the battles of Dresden and Leipzig. After Napoleon's defeat in this last battle, he returned to Naples in an attempt to save his crown. However, his shaky policy in 1813-1815 eventually led to his dethronement and his execution on October 13, 1815.
